Alright Will, sit down time:

i got my leader G1 Megs for $38 and he is damn worth it. It is a great, solid, pretty hefty mold. The tank mode is amazing and accurate to real tanks with incredible detail, moving turret and treads and the extra guns to make it beautifully accurate. There is very little robot tellable from the vehicle mode. Transformation is fun, can be fast but very satisfying.

the robot mode looks so much like G1 Megs, has a beautiful head and very nice detail. there is detail everywhere you look, even beneath plates of armor that move! The paint job is gorgeous and the fusion cannon, while a little long in the back, looks very good with the firing missile part back. All the paint lost in the combiner wars figures was made up for this guy. He has very little kibble, and to me the tank treads on the back make him look bulkier and much more imposing. He is still quite posable despite everything and you can put his extra guns on his legs for more bulk look. He looks like he should turn into a gun but doesn't! It to me is a true G1 Megs brought to life. The Armada version is not as good since the silver makes the figure and the armada just doesn't look as close to the original as the G1 version.

I would seriously have bought the guy at full price but managed to get him for cheaper. He was well worth full price to me. If you really want Armada, I'd say wait for massive discounts, but I would get the G1 Megs if you have the chance. MOVING ON... I have some stuff to say about the Leader seekers. I was about to buy them the other day because they are quite cheap (35$cdn/27$US in stores) and as I was holding the Starscream box, I took a good look at him and realized how dissapointing he was as a toy.

The first thing that made me flinch was the headsculpt. For some mind boggling reason, Hasbro has the hardest time coming up with a good seeker head. They put lines that dont need to be there. Takara does that with the masterpiece, giving him a pronounced chin but what Hasbro does here is that and more. I hadnt noticed it before but the nose is all sorts of wack:

Image
Transformers Generations Combiner Wars Starscream Gallery

He has these two lines that branch out at the top of his nose, making it look like it was pinned to his face and not part of it, kinda like he's the scarecrow from wizard of oz. Your eyes go directly to his nose:

Image

It was more distracting than I thought it would be. And his eyes are totally lifeless. I dont know, the faceculpt just didnt scream Starscream to me in the least and was more generic seeker (which was probably their goal).

But beyond that, I realized how this mold doesnt work for a seeker at all. Sure, when you look at it, the first thing you see is the chest and you'd think it was a great rendition of the IDW seeker design below:

Image

But if you take more than a second to look elsewhere, you realize that its only the torso area that is similar and everything else is very different:

Image
Transformers Generations Combiner Wars Starscream Gallery

The exhausts end up in back of the head instead of the back of the feet, there is no tail find on the feet, there are no triangular parts at the sides of the head, the arms are all wrong and my biggest pet peeve: the wing design in the back is not at all that of a seeker's. Instead of having the two wings, you have thing canopy with absolutely no color. Here is a better and far more definite version of that IDW design and you can tell how it looks very different to the Leader class:

Image
Transformers Generations Starscream Gallery

Another seeker trait is of course the seeker chest and the designs show the nosecone extending beyond the mid section. It doesnt on the Leader mold, making it look more like a chest design imitating a nosecone rather than an actual nosecone, unlike the Legion class toy (from RTS), which had a fake nosecone chest but clearly intended it to portray the actual nosecone rather than a chest design resembling the nosecone.

Image
Transformers Reveal The Shield Starscream Gallery

And please note that I am not being nitpicky on the hallowness or any of that, this is specifically design and how it fails to capture what its trying to do.

This made me think about Jetfire. Why wasnt I this nitpicky? Well, turns out its because he is indeed far better suited for this mold and a lot more care went into him.

Here is the animation model they were basing it off and trying to modernize:

Image

The wings in the back have colour (as they of course would), but this mold doesnt, right?

Nope, Jetfire had those exact colours on his wings in the back:

Image
Transformers Generations Jetfire Gallery

Also, look at how well it recreates the torso area, and making it extra sleek. It definitely benefits on the fake chest, giving you a show accurate chest for the robot mode while giving you a nice cockpit area to replicate the G1 toy. The headsculpt is also spot on (with that awesome extra mask), and they give us those red turrets which you can pose to recreate the G1 look (using the toy's look of having a space between them).

So all in all, there was a lot more love that went into this mold being Jetfire while the Seekers look like an afterthought, especially when you look at the wing area. The same mold that beautifully homaged two distinct Jetfire looks at once totally fails at giving us a good looking seeker.

Anyways, this was all to say that I am never getting these seeker toys, no matter the price and you can see my logic behind that.

I hardly profess much knowledge of IDW - but isn't there radically different Jet designs depending on the artist and the Legends/Basic class ones are only representing one of several artistic types for the Decepticon Jets when they are not F-15s. Perhaps they were looking more at the more F-22 like designs as the inspiration for the Jetfire adaptation.

Besides no one said the toyline had to be based on the comic -sometimes it is sometimes it isn't as it doesn't always share the same continuity with it and only does when the decide it does for short periods how comic accurate they are likely only matters to the small number of people who read the comics to everyone else it's just "Starscream" it's not like it's required for it to be so specific.

This especially applies outside of the USA where the toys do not have comics with them, so those consumers have no basis of comparison.

In a way I see the current toy line as being a bit like Beast Hunters was sometimes it matches up with the media other times it wildly fails to.

Leading to the conclusion that the toy universe isn't really the same thing it just shares some designs - sort of like how Ironhide pinched his comic body design from war For Cybertron for a while.
